yes. all the Victoria ones are. downtown and Langford same owner.

 

and uptown and vic west will be same owner.   jeremy wilson of 17-mile and adrenaline zip course.

 

 

 

Browns Socialhouse Uptown was recognized as the most successful of 60 Browns location in Canada at the Browns Restaurant Group Awards.

 

The Franchise of the Year Award went to owners Jeremy Wilson and Norm Wilson, who opened their location in 2016.

 

“Our entire team has worked very hard to create something special and we’re really proud of this achievement,” Jeremy Wilson said.

 

Wilson and his team intend to expand to Vic West, where they will open the Island’s first Browns Crafthouse this summer at the corner of Bay Street and Tyee Road. — Times Colonist

 

 
 
wilson is also a local VicFD firefighter in his day job.

I checked it out tonight, very impressive room. There is a massive garage door and part of the bar is actually outside! The beer menu, complete with pricing and alcohol percentage , is massive! Great to see a beer menu with so many local breweries represented. The food menu is decent sized and they have an all day breakfast. We shared the Howling wings, very good, and some Cauliflower bites, also very good. I will definitely return as most of the other meals I saw coming by our table looked great.

 

Good to see a new pub/ restaurant open in Vic West, and a short walk from home!
